AMI Construction is a growing asphalt paving contractor specializing in commercial and multifamily parking lots, as well as residential developments. Known for quality work, reliable service, and strong relationships, AMI has built its reputation on doing things the right way—with integrity, teamwork, and excellence in our craft.

We’re growing, and we’re looking for a Human Resources Director who will help strengthen our foundation by leading people-focused initiatives that attract, develop, and retain the best talent in the industry.

Job Title:
HR Director

The HR Director supports AMI’s people and culture initiatives by working directly with leadership and employees to create a positive, high-performance work environment. This role balances strategic HR support with hands-on daily HR activity. The HR Director will help drive recruitment and retention, support workforce development, and ensure compliance across all HR practices.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ead aggressive recruiting efforts across all divisions in a competitive construction labor market.
  • Create retention strategies that address construction industry challenges (seasonal work, Saturday schedules, etc)
  • Address employee concerns, conflicts, and workplace issues with fairness and speed
  • Drive our employee-first culture through team building initiatives and recognition programs
  • Manage all HR systems, policies, and employee handbook administration
  • Ensure compliance with federal and Tennessee employment laws, OSHA regulations, and DOT requirements
  • Handle workers' compensation claims and return-to-work programs
  • Maintain accurate employee records and HRIS systems
  • Manage benefits administration and open enrollment
  • Support development of division-specific training including toolbox talks and certifications
  • Ensure proper documentation of safety training and credentials
Skills
  • Bachelor's Degree in Human Resources or related field.
  • PHR/SPHR certification and/or SHRM-SCP certification preferred.
  • 5+ years of progressive HR experience, including management responsibility—construction or field-based industries preferred.
  • Experience working within an Entrepreneurial Operating System (EOS) is preferred.
  • Strong working knowledge of employment law, compliance, and HR best practices.
  • Proven success recruiting and developing employees in skilled trades or construction environments.
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ills with a hands-on, approachable leadership style. (Being bilingual is a plus.)
